﻿* {margin: auto;padding: 0;}

body {background:#000; font-family:arial; font-size:10px; color:#fff;text-align:center;background:url(/images/fundosite.jpg) repeat-x #000}
td tr {
font-size:12px;

}

h3{border-bottom:1px solid #7c8389;padding-bottom:5px;color:#ffffff;font-size:21px;font-weight:bold;margin-bottom:12px;text-shadow: 2px 2px 1px #666; }
  
p {margin-top:0px;padding-top:0px;margin-bottom:0px;padding-bottom:0px;}

input {border:1px solid #999;}
textarea {border:1px solid #999;}
 
a img{border: 0px;}

.left{float:left;}

.clear{clear:both;}

.right{float:right;}

a { color: #fff;text-decoration:none;}
a:hover { color: #5a5a5a;text-decoration:underline;}




:focus{outline:none;}
 
a {text-decoration:none;cursor:pointer;}
 
#main_body {width:960px;margin-top:20px;text-align:left;padding-bottom:15px;}
 
#main_barra {height:30px;width:100%;background:#f1f1f1;border-bottom:1px dashed #c1c1c1;}
#main_b {width:960px;padding-top:9px;}
#barra {height:30px;float:left;margin-right:15px;}
#paineltop {width:725px;text-align:right;float:right;font-weight:bold;}
#paineltop input {border:1px solid #fff;background:#ccc;height:17px;font-size:11px}
.pmenu_content{font-weight:bold;height:30px;text-align:right}
.pmenu_content ul{list-style-type:none;}
.pmenu_content li{float:right;margin-right:10px;}
.pmenu_content li:hover{background:#757d83;margin-right:10px;float:left;color:#ffffff;}
.pmenu_content a{color:#d4d7da;display:block;height:26px;line-height:26px;}
.pmenu_content a:hover{color:#ffffff;height:26px;text-decoration:none;}
li.pmenu_content_active{background:#757d83;margin-right:10px;float:right;color:#ffffff;}
.pmenu_content_active a{color:#ffffff;}

#header{clear:both;height:38px;background: url(/images/header-r-corner.gif) right no-repeat;background:#999;}

#logo{height:68px;float:left;margin-right:15px;}

/* Menu Part */
#menu_body{height:38px;width:775px;text-align:left;float:left;font-weight:bold;color:#ffffff;background:#000;}
.menu_content{padding:6px 5px 0px 5px;font-weight:bold;}
.menu_content ul{list-style-type:none;}
.menu_content li{float:left;margin-right:10px;}
.menu_content li:hover{background:#757d83;margin-right:10px;float:left;color:#ffffff;}
.menu_content a{color:#d4d7da;padding:5px 15px 5px 15px;display:block;}
.menu_content a:hover{color:#ffffff;padding:5px 15px 5px 15px;}
li.menu_content_active{background:#757d83;margin-right:10px;float:left;color:#ffffff;}
.menu_content_active a{color:#ffffff;padding:5px 15px 5px 15px;}

 /* Search Part Starts Here */
 .search_body{margin-top:2px;color:#2b2f32;width:220px;height:20px;float:right;background:url(/images/search_input_bg.gif) no-repeat;}
 .search_body a{padding:0px;display:inline;}
 .search_body a:hover{padding:0px;display:inline-block;}
 .search_body input[type="text"]{margin:1px 0px 0px 3px;width:180px;color:#2b2f32;background:none;border:none; vertical-align:top;}
 .search_body input[type="image"]{margin:1px 0px 0px 8px;}
 /* Search Part Ends Here */

/* Menu Part */

/* Content Body Starts Here */

#content_body{clear:both;background:url(/images/content_bg.gif) top left repeat-x;margin-top:35px;text-align:left;padding:10px;font-size:12px;color:#fff;}

#top_content{height:345px;clear:both;}

#main_info{width:330px;float:left;color:#39454e;font-size:13px;}
#main_info p{padding-top:10px;line-height:20px;}

/* Content Slider */
#slider_shadow{background:url(../images/content_slider_shadow.gif) right bottom no-repeat;height:345px;}
#content_slider{float:right;outline:0;width:600px;}
/* Content Slider */

.headers{border-bottom:1px solid #7c8389;padding-bottom:5px;color:#39454e;font-size:21px;font-weight:bold;margin-bottom:12px;}

.headers1{border-bottom:1px solid #7c8389;padding-bottom:5px;color:#ffffff;font-size:21px;font-weight:bold;margin-bottom:12px;text-shadow: 2px 2px 1px #666; }

.small_headers{padding-top:5px;color:#39454e;font-size:14px;font-weight:bold;margin-bottom:7px;margin-top:12px;}

.sub_headers{border-bottom:1px solid #7c8389;;color:#fff;font-size:18px;font-weight:bold;margin-top:3px;text-shadow: 2px 2px 3px #000;background:#666;}

#corners {-moz-border-radius: 10px 10px 10px 10px;background:#666;padding:5px;border:1px solid #666;filter:progid:DXImageTransform.Microsoft.Shadow(color='#666666',direction='120',strength='3');box-shadow: 3px 2px 3px #999;-moz-box-shadow: 3px 2px 3px #999;-webkit-box-shadow: 3px 2px 3px #999;-moz-border-radius: 10px 10px 10px 10px;float:left;width:98%;
}

#bottom_content{clear:both;margin-top:10px;padding-bottom:15px;}

#left_content{padding-bottom:30px;width:100%;float:left;color:#fff;font-size:12px;text-align:left;}

			.movie78 {
				width: 990px;
				height: 220px;
			}
			div.movie78 {
				width: 990px;
				height: 220px;
				
				border: 0px solid #bbbbbb;

			}

#right_content{clear:right;width:300px;float:right;color:#5d6c77;font-size:12px;text-align:left;}

.right_links{color:#fff;font-size:13px;text-align:left;text-decoration:none;border:1px solid #999;background:#c1c1c1;padding:4px}
.right_links li{color:#fff;list-style-type:none;padding:5px 0px 5px 0px;text-shadow: 1px 1px 3px #ccc;margin:0px;}
.right_links li:hover{list-style-type:none;padding:5px 0px 5px 0px;color:#fff;text-shadow: 2px 2px 1px #666;}
.right_links1 li{list-style-type:none;padding:5px 0px 5px 0px;}
.right_links a{color:#fff;font-size:13px;text-align:left;text-decoration:none;font-weight:bold;}
.right_links a:hover{color:#ffffff;font-size:13px;text-align:left;text-decoration:none;font-weight:bold;}

.read_more_btn{width:82px;height:24px;margin-right:0px;}

#follow_us{margin-top:12px;}
#follow_us img{margin-right:12px;}

/* Contact Form */
.contact input[type="text"]{width:300px;border:1px solid #39454e;background:#e1e1e1;margin-top:2px;padding:3px;}
.contact input[type="text"]:hover{width:300px;border:1px solid #39454e;background:#ffffff;margin-top:2px;padding:3px;}
label.error {color: red; padding-left: 20px; } 
/* Contact From */

/*Content Body Ends Here */

/* Footer Starts Here */
#footer{clear:both;color:#5d6c77;border-top:1px solid #bebebe;padding-top:5px;}
#footer a{text-decoration:none;color:#5d6c77;font-size:12px;}
#footer span{padding:0px 5px 0px 5px;}
#footer a:hover{text-decoration:underline;color:#5d6c77;font-size:12px;}

/* Footer Ends Here */
		/* menu styles */
		ul.menuh {
			margin: 0; padding: 0;
			font-size:12px;
			color:#333333;
		}            
		
		ul.menuh li.subv {
			padding: 0px;
			width: 110px;
			float: left;
			list-style: none;
			font-weight:normal;
			text-decoration: none;
			background:url(/issets/imagens/fundomenu.jpg) no-repeat left;
			line-height:22px;
			height:39px;
			margin-left:1px;
			margin-right:1px;
		}            
		ul.menuh ul.menuv {
			display: none; position: absolute; margin-left: -1px;
			padding:2px;
		}            
		ul.menuh ul.menuv ul {
			left: 110px;
		}            
		ul.menuh a {
			padding-left: 5px;
			display: block;
			text-decoration: none;
			font-size:12px;
			color: #000;
			font-weight:bold;
			height:39px;
			line-height:39px;
		}            
		
		ul.menuh li a:hover {
			color: #000;
			background:url(/images/fmenu.jpg) no-repeat;
		}            
		ul.menuh a.seta {
		}            
		ul.menuv, ul.menuv ul {
			margin: 0;
			padding: 0;
			margin-left:2px;
			width: 150px;
			background:#f1f1f1;
			/*background:#9CC0D1;*/
		}            
		ul.menuv li {
			position: relative; list-style: none; border: 0px;
		}   
				 
		ul.menuv li a {
			display: block; text-decoration: none;
			color: #000; padding: 5px 10px 5px 5px;
			height:30px;
			line-height:30px;
			width:140px;
		}
		
		/* Fix IE. Hide from IE Mac \*/
		* html ul.menuv li {
		float: left; height: 1%;
		} 
		
		* ul.menuv li a {
		}
		/* End */
		
		ul.menuv ul {
			position: absolute; z-index: 10000; display: none; left: 169px; top: -1px;
		}            
		
		ul.menuv li.submenu ul {
			display: none;
		} 
		
		ul.menuv a.seta {
		}      
		
		ul.menuv li a:hover {
			color: #fff;
		}
		ul.menuv li a {
			font-size:11px;
			font-weight:normal;
			height:18px;
			line-height:18px;
		}

 
/**
 * jQuery lightBox plugin
 * This jQuery plugin was inspired and based on Lightbox 2 by Lokesh Dhakar (http://www.huddletogether.com/projects/lightbox2/)
 * and adapted to me for use like a plugin from jQuery.
 * @name jquery-lightbox-0.5.css
 * @author Leandro Vieira Pinho - http://leandrovieira.com
 * @version 0.5
 * @date April 11, 2008
 * @category jQuery plugin
 * @copyright (c) 2008 Leandro Vieira Pinho (leandrovieira.com)
 * @license CC Attribution-No Derivative Works 2.5 Brazil - http://creativecommons.org/licenses/by-nd/2.5/br/deed.en_US
 * @example Visit http://leandrovieira.com/projects/jquery/lightbox/ for more informations about this jQuery plugin
 */
#jquery-overlay {
	position: absolute;
	top: 0;
	left: 0;
	z-index: 90;
	width: 100%;
	height: 500px;
}
#jquery-lightbox {
	position: absolute;
	top: 0;
	left: 0;
	width: 100%;
	z-index: 100;
	text-align: center;
	line-height: 0;
}
#jquery-lightbox a img { border: none; }
#lightbox-container-image-box {
	position: relative;
	background-color: #fff;
	width: 250px;
	height: 250px;
	margin: 0 auto;
}
#lightbox-container-image { padding: 10px; }
#lightbox-loading {
	position: absolute;
	top: 40%;
	left: 0%;
	height: 25%;
	width: 100%;
	text-align: center;
	line-height: 0;
}
#lightbox-nav {
	position: absolute;
	top: 0;
	left: 0;
	height: 100%;
	width: 100%;
	z-index: 10;
}
#lightbox-container-image-box > #lightbox-nav { left: 0; }
#lightbox-nav a { outline: none;}
#lightbox-nav-btnPrev, #lightbox-nav-btnNext {
	width: 49%;
	height: 100%;
	zoom: 1;
	display: block;
}
#lightbox-nav-btnPrev { 
	left: 0; 
	float: left;
}
#lightbox-nav-btnNext { 
	right: 0; 
	float: right;
}
#lightbox-container-image-data-box {
	font: 10px Verdana, Helvetica, sans-serif;
	background-color: #fff;
	margin: 0 auto;
	line-height: 1.4em;
	overflow: auto;
	width: 100%;
	padding: 0 10px 0;
}
#lightbox-container-image-data {
	padding: 0 10px; 
	color: #666; 
}
#lightbox-container-image-data #lightbox-image-details { 
	width: 70%; 
	float: left; 
	text-align: left; 
}	
#lightbox-image-details-caption { font-weight: bold; }
#lightbox-image-details-currentNumber {
	display: block; 
	clear: left; 
	padding-bottom: 1.0em;	
}			
#lightbox-secNav-btnClose {
	width: 66px; 
	float: right;
	padding-bottom: 0.7em;	
}		
 
